jquery - 我的 jQuery 脚本不工作......但我不确定为什么

标签 jquery html css jquery-hover

首先,我知道这可以完全通过 CSS 来实现,但我最近学习了 jQuery,尽管我会尝试通过 jQuery 来完成它以帮助提高我的技能。

我正在努力做到这一点,所以当我将鼠标悬停在图像上时,它会变成半不透明……我知道这应该很简单。但我想我一定是漏掉了什么 我的标记是 <img class="port-item-img" src="..."> 我的脚本是

    $(document).ready(function(){
        $(".port-item-img").hover(function() {
                $(this).css("opacity", "0.5");
            };
        );
    });

这不应该工作的原因是什么?

最佳答案

这应该可行

 $(document).ready(function(){
    $(".port-item-img").hover(function() {
            $(this).css("opacity", "0.5");
        });
 });

你为 添加了 ;

关于jquery - 我的 jQuery 脚本不工作......但我不确定为什么,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/26135163/

相关文章:

html - 将元素对齐到 HTML 表格单元格的底部

html - 如何让导航栏在较小的浏览器上出现在两行上?

jquery - 仅适用于包含 div 的元素的选择器

php - MP3 播放器,如grooveshark

jquery - 如何使用 onclick 函数进行验证

html - 百分比问题,让元素跟随 100% 浏览器宽度

html - 让 buddypress 管理栏固定在页面顶部

Javascript - 获取未定义元素的宽度

javascript - 如何检查是否在 Jquery/Javascript 中选择了所有单选按钮(已呈现)

html - 如何为不同的语言使用不同的字体?